Consider Bob Books, Set 1 by Bobby Lynn Maslen.
“Bob Books, Set 1 is a bite-sized decodable set that introduces a few letter sounds at a time so young readers can complete whole, self-contained books quickly. The boxed set and colored illustrations keep sessions playful, and the steady, sound-by-sound rollout is useful for phonics-first practice. Main limitation: sentences are tightly controlled and heavily repetitive, so adults seeking narrative depth or vocabulary variety will find it thin. No formal lesson plans or hands-on exercises are included — it’s meant for read-aloud and repeated practice.”
